Key Windows (UK) Ltd Added by editor 0 reviews Listed in Business 11 High Street Twyford Reading Berkshire RG10 9AB 0118-934 3433 www.keywindows.co.uk Add to Favorites Claim Listing Updated: Dec 31, 2013 Overview Reviews Double Glazing Installers Add Your Review Please login or register to add your review.